| ObjectiveTo investigate the hepatoprotective mechanism and components absorbed into blood of Sanwei Ganjiang San(SWGJS),we study the protection of liver mitochondrial structure and function,establish an alcoholic liver injury model and a ConA immunological liver injury model,so as to make a foundation for the further research about SWGJS.Methods1.72 SD rats were randomly divided into normal group,alcohol model group,silymarin positive group,SWGJS high,medium and low dose intervention group.In addition to the normal group,the rats were fed with 55%alcohol in the morning and fed with the corresponding dose of distilled water in the normal group for 10 days.The rat model of alcoholic liver injury was prepared.After 12 hours of the last administration,2%sodium pentobarbital anesthesia,collection of abdominal aorta blood,separation of serum for detection of liver function indexes of ALT,AST,liver was used for HE staining for pathological observation,the extracted liver mitochondria were used to detect mitochondrial membrane potential,membrane permeability,SOD,8-OHdG,respiratory chain enzyme complex Ⅰ,Ⅲ;preparation of liver homogenate to detect MDA,GSH,GSH-Px,the expression of Nrf2,Bachl and HO-1 mRNA in hepatocytes was detected by RT-PCR,the expression of Nrf2,Bachl and HO-1 protein in liver tissue was detected by Western Blot.2.72 KM mice were randomly divided into normal group,ConA model group,silymarin positive group,SWGJS high,medium and low dose intervention group.In addition to the normal group,each group were administered corresponding drug Volume 1 times,continuous 7d,normal groups with distilled water of equal volume in the last administration after 12h,except the normal group,other groups were injected into the tail vein of ConA 25mg/kg,preparation of ConA immune liver injury model.After modeling 4h eye blood collection,the isolated serum was used to detect liver function ALT and AST,the isolated liver was used for HE staining for pathological examination,extraction of liver mitochondriawas detected by mitochondrial membrane potential,SOD,8-OHdG,preparation of liver homogenate for determination of MDA,GSH,GSH-Px.3.Through the determination of UPLC-MS and the establishment of the chemical composition database of SWGJS,the samples of SWGJS containing serum,blank serum and single or compound were screened by Peakview software.With 6-gingerol reference substance,looking for SWGJS into the blood composition.Results1.The levels of ALT and AST in serum of alcohol model group were increased after same,suggesting that the 6-gingerol may be in the form of blood transfusion.Conclusion1.The effect of SWGJS on liver protection is related to the protection of mitochondria in the liver,specifically to protect the mitochondrial membrane structure,increase the number of antioxidant enzymes,reduce oxidative damage to DNA and restore mitochondrial redox system,regulate endogenous anti-Oxidation system,to reduce the body lipid antioxidant response,up-regulation of Nrf2,Bachl and HO-1 gene and protein expression.2.The UPLC-MS test shows 6-gingerol may be the composition of SWGJS into the blood,and with the prototype into the blood. |
